Azure breaches almost always start at Entra ID (formerly Azure AD), not at a VM or storage account. Get identity right and the rest gets dramatically easier:
- Conditional Access — require compliant device + phishing-resistant MFA for any privileged role.
- Privileged Identity Management (PIM) — make Global Admin and Owner roles just-in-time, with approval and time-bound activation.
- Workload identities — replace client secrets with Federated Identity Credentials (OIDC) wherever possible.
- Break-glass accounts — at least two, with FIDO2 keys stored physically, monitored aggressively.
